Amazing Creations At The Carlsbad Art Farm

by The Editors on July 7, 2010

Kris With Session Three Painting Class 2010

A crew of budding artists shows off their work after a week at the Carlsbad Art Farm, according to a post on the school’s blog.

During the week, students learn to sketch animals; color mix using a limited pallet; how to block in their subject for a painting; a little about animal anatomy, and then use the colors they create on their own pallet to render their subject (in this case: a bunny, chickens and a mouse on a wheel). These students will be entering Grade 4 this fall.

TGIF July 9: Big Time Operator

by The Editors on July 5, 2010

M 840787Ae24294226B7E79F94734Bed99If Carlsbadistan were ever to name the kings of TGIF Jazz In The Park it would no doubt crown Warren Lovell’s Big Time Operator. This big beat, jazz, lounge band has played 11 of the 25 and on Friday July 9, 2010 they’re going to be swingin’ up Stagecoach Park again with their big band sound.

Led by singer Warren Lovell, this ten piece band has the class and excitement to make your event memorable. . . Winners of the 1997, 1998, 1999, 2000 and 2001 San Diego Music Awards for Best Big Band, and the 1998 Jim Croces Excellence in Entertainment Award. Big Time Operator excels at playing classic big band arrangements, latin arrangements, and impressive original songs. They are true to the past and yet completely contemporary Entertainers Extraordinaire!

They’ve “got a rhythmn stingin’ hot, they’re going to put you on the spot.” Show starts at 6 PM. Martinis are highly encouraged.

July Kicks Off With A Bank Robbery

by The Editors on July 3, 2010

The people in dark masks, hooded sweatshirts “claimed to be armed” while robbing the Carlsbad Citi bank at 1810 Marron Rd. on Thursday, July 1, 2010, according to a story in The Coast News.

Carlsbad Police responded to the scene and located a vehicle, abandoned with the motor still running, behind the Marshall’s Store, which is located in the same shopping center. It was discovered that this vehicle had been reported as stolen from the Los Angeles area. The surrounding area was searched by a police K-9 and other officers, however the suspects were not located.

We haven’t had a bank robbery since March and it was at the same bank. In fact, the Citibank on Marron Rd has been robbed at least three times in the past three years. Seems to be a favorite with the bad guys.

Fireworks On The Fourth Of July

by The Editors on July 1, 2010

082309  13

We’ve been hearing rumors that there may be some unofficial fireworks going off near the beach come July 4. We’ve seen them before and they were insanely professional. Carlsbadistan’s finest, however, seem to frown on those festivities. That’s why this year we’re going to watch the Red, White, & Boom fireworks at Legoland first.

The Legoland fireworks show is going down at 8:30 PM, July 4, 2010. The best place to view them is from the lower parking lot at the Sheraton Carlsbad Resort & Spa. Trust us, you really don’t want to get any closer than that.
